- Details of Event
- 7 December 1937: Shale Miner Killed - Henry Hunter (27) a shale miner, 64 Livingstone Station, Mid Calder, was killed to-day in an accident in No.26 Shale Mine, West Calder. Hunter was putting up props to secure the roof in his working place, when he was partly buried under debris. He died shortly afterwards. Hunter leaves a wife and one child. [Evening Telegraph 7 December 1937]
